Transaction 269230116e896cd8a9cfc3d9e1e43263e9cf01d92e1841a7f3fe42c7f15e8269
1 Input
1 Output
-
269230116e896cd8a9cfc3d9e1e43263e9cf01d92e1841a7f3fe42c7f15e8269:0
- value
- 1499985310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e4e79011ad4ef43c764cdb646f3e2856c956ba9 OP_EQUAL
- address
- 3AHfSxDECq3c4i47y9TmP4tJPtC26H7YXi